2x -3y = 13
4x -y = -9
Multiply the second equation by -3 to make the coefficient of Y opposite the first equation.
4x -y = -9 x -3 = -12x + 3y = 27
Now add this to the first equation:
2x -12x = -10x
-3y +3y = 0
13 +27 = 40
Now you have :
-10x = 40
Divide each side by -10:
x = 40 / -10
x = -4
Now you have a value for x, replace that into the first equation and solve for y:
2(-4) - 3y = 13
-8 - 3y = 13
Add 8 to both sides:
-3y = 21
Divide both sides by -3:
y = 21/-3
y = -7
Now you have X = -4 and y = -7
(-4,-7)
Answer:
- as written, -57
- as perhaps intended, C. -11
Step-by-step explanation:
The expression shown evaluates as ...
7 + 32(-5 +1)/2 = 7 +32(-4)/2 = 7 -128/2 = 7 -64 = -57
_____
If we assume your "32" is supposed to be 3², or 3^2, then the expression evaluates differently:
7 +3²(-5 +1)/2 = 7 + 9(-4)/2 = 7 -36/2 = 7 -18 = -11 . . . . matches choice C
